Attualmente stiamo lavorando per integrare alcuni computer Linux nel nostro dominio di Active Directory. Ho praticamente impostato tutto, ma sto cercando di capire come fare in modo che Linux monti automaticamente le cartelle di rete in base ai gruppi di directory attive in cui si trova l'utente.
Se apro un terminale e id $user
lo digito, mi mostreranno tutti i gruppi di dominio. Restituirà qualcosa di simile:
uid=66061422(user1) gid=66060801(domain^users) groups=66060801(domain^users),66061473(inventory^share^users),66061474(picture^share^users),66061441(managers),66061496(spark^users),66061448(gps^department),66061469(gps^share^users),66061490(warehouse^department),66061471(management^share^users),66061472(backup^share^users)
o
uid=66061406(user2) gid=66060801(domain^users) groups=66060801(domain^users),66061473(inventory^share^users),66061496(spark^users),66061490(warehouse^department),66061472(backup^share^users)
Ho bisogno di uno script che id
l'utente quando il login e cercare l'uscita per termini come gps^share^users
e se esiste quindi utilizzando le proprie credenziali di utente montare la condivisione come //server/gps
a /media/gps
.
Su un computer l'ho impostato per montare automaticamente le condivisioni di dominio, fstab
ma si montano automaticamente per chiunque acceda a quel computer, se usano le credenziali della stessa persona anziché le proprie credenziali.
Eventuali suggerimenti, suggerimenti, suggerimenti o altro sarebbero utili anche se è solo per dirmi che ciò che sto cercando di fare non è possibile.